Angola: Chief Justice Wants Speedy Trials

22 October 2009


Uíge — Prisoners' remand time should have a privileged treatment, since there might be cases of wrong imprisonment, considered Wednesday in the northern Uíge Province the Supreme Court Chief Justice, Cristiano André.

The top judge made such statement during a lecture to officials from provinces like Uíge, Cabinda, Zaire and Kwanza Norte, who are receiving training at the National Institute of Judicial Studies (INEJ).

On the occasion, the Chief Justice said that non fulfilment of such law has undermined many people's rights, that is, citizens wrongly placed on remand.

During the lecture, Cristiano André stressed the importance of fulfilling the legal deadlines during the lawsuit, as well as the various procedures.

The Supreme Court Chief Justice also met judicial magistrates and workers of the Provincial Court and Prosecution Office.
